Suzanne Lisa Suzy Kolber (born Suzanne Lisa Suzy Kolber) is a American sports journalist also known as a sportscaster as well as a producer at ESPN. Her previous employers include CBS Sports and Fox Sports. Kolber is a native of Pennsylvania and received her graduate diploma from University of Miami. Her career in the field began as the Video Coordinator at CBS Sports, New York City. She won the city's Sports Emmy award during her time working at WTVJ-TV Miami. Also, she worked at WPLG-TV in Miami and WPEC-TV which is located in West Palm Beach Florida. In 1993, she joined ESPN and was picked to be one of the first anchors for ESPN2 as it came out that year. Fox Sports hired her after three years of working at ESPN2. Then, in 1999, she re-joined ESPN and currently serves as the host of 'Monday Night Countdown.
